Explore the complex dynamics of the global energy transition in this thought-provoking conference talk from the Aspen Ideas Festival. Delve into the economic realities and challenges of moving away from hydrocarbons, examining the pace of change and the often-overlooked macroeconomic factors influencing policy decisions. Gain insights from two financial experts as they discuss why Middle Eastern economies investing in renewable energy still rely heavily on oil trade, and investigate the critical role of mineral resources in renewable technology development. Understand the intricate balance between sustainable energy goals and economic dependencies in this hour-long session that challenges conventional thinking about the energy transition.
